QEDtool: A Python package for numerical quantum information in quantum electrodynamics

Description

qedtool is a Python-based object-oriented tool that allows users to calculate quantum information quantities from relativistic perturbative quantum electrodynamics (QED) at tree-level. It contains functions that define 3-vectors, 4-vectors, Dirac spinors, propagators and quantum states, that can be Lorentz transformed in their corresponding representations. With qedtool, users can calculate

  • polarized tree-level QED Feynman amplitudes,
  • scattering probabilities and quantum informational quantities for pure and mixed polarization states,
  • the full emitted quantum state (with built-in functions for 2-to-2 particle scattering).

From the emitted quantum state, users can compute

  • the differential cross section (2-to-2 scattering)
  • the degree of two-particle entanglement of emitted states,
  • n-particle Stokes parameters,
  • single- and two-particle degree of polarization.

These quantities can be studied from arbitrary reference frames by means of Lorentz transformations. The documentation of qedtool is contained within our paper:

DOI

The notebooks/ directory contains Jupyter notebooks with examples as presented in our paper; from defining and performing operations vectors, spinors, and particles, to complete scattering processes. If you find qedtool useful in your research, please cite our paper.

Installation

In addition to cloning qedtool from this GitHub repository, it can be installed using the following command line:

  pip install qedtool

License

qedtool is licensed under the MIT license.
